The Accent Mark

 

Just the name of The Accent Mark in Cleveland is synonymous with the words “fine gifts” The name has been around for some 25 years and the two owners have an eye for creative gift giving. Owned by Brigitte Miller and Bobbye Creasman, the shop is an elegant addition to The Shops at Spring Creek Town Center.

 

The lines of products  range from Aromatique, Crabtree & Evelyn, Thymes, Tyler Candles, and a new line  of candles called Votivo. A spectacular addition includes custom jewelry. The popular Troll Beads are available at The Accent Mark. This line allow customers to literally build their own bracelets and necklaces from an array of spectacular beads. The line is getting rave reviews as customers purchase the gifts and then recipients shop and add more beads and color to this special piece of jewelry.

 

The Accent Mark carries a line of gourmet candy called Mark Avenue Chocolates.  This delectable candy counter also offers some selections in sugar-free. Brigitte and Bobbye are mother and daughter and have a special knack for gift selection. Their shop is inviting, quaint and cozy, making shopping  a  delightful experience.

Guppies Children’s Boutique

 

Be prepared to “ooh and aah” when you step inside the new Guppies children’s boutique just opened in the Spring Creek Town Center.
 
Tonya Suits, the talented owner, has three children, Bailey, age 6 and twin sons, Cayden & Carter, who are 9-months old. She knows what young mothers today want and need to outfit their infants to toddlers. Tonya and husband Perry have worked together to make her “dream shop” a reality — and it shows when you walk inside. Tonya has great experience in retail, having worked for many years at The Accent Mark.
 
Whether it’s a newborn or a six year old, Guppies has something for everyone. She added an accessory line that offers eye-catching hats and headbands for little girls — and for little boys, there are smart pieces of apparel as well as shoes.
 
Some of the widely-known lines offered at Guppies include: Lemon loves Lime, Biscotti, Kate Mack, Deux par Deux (European line), Anavini (smocked outfits), Mom and Me (smocked), Chatti Patti (fun flounce pant outfits) Miss Tee Ve(cotton sets too cute), Elephantino, and Luna
Luna, Tonya’s favorite european line .
 
Other brands include: Magnolia Baby (baby layettes) Luli & Me, Little English, Rabbit Moon, Baby Lulu, Twirls and Twigs (organic materials) . Pixi Lilies, along with Gigi’s and Jamie Ray hats are also included. The Baby Bunch Gift line will be a hit, along with the His Gem line which is a series of cotton gowns with scriptures and inspirational words.
 
Tonya added an infant to toddler shoe line ranging from: Lelli Lelly Shoes, Puddle Jumpers, Kid Express, Morgan and Milo, Livi Moo Shoe Trainers and more. Guppies, offers free monogramming on all Anavini, Mom & Me,  and Rosalina Basics.

Paisley

 

Paisley is one of the unique new shops that now calls Spring Creek Town Center “home.” Paisley offers all things personalized. Their specialty is monogramming, invitations, stationery and an array of personalized gifts.
 
The gift line runs the gamut from kitchen towels, to photo frames, infant bibs, tote bags, insulated carry bags, cosmetic bags, jewelry bags, and much more. Stationary, note cards and more can also be found in the shop selections.
 
The concept for the shop came as the result of a friendship between two creative young women who shared a love for personalization and saw a need in Cleveland for gift shop that offers “all things personal…”
 
Amy Tippens and Anna Ballard are owners of Paisley and when they opened their doors officially on July 25, the rush of customers confirmed what they knew all along —- personalization makes the perfect gift. Paisley takes a birthday gift from every day to one of a kind, a shower gift from ordinary to extra ordinary, and bath towels from common place to a decorated space.
 
From the day the doors opened, Paisley has had a steady stream of visitors looking for shower gifts, bridal gifts, bridesmaids gifts, birthday items, and home decorations. Studio d photography

 

Studio D is a complete photography and design center that brings a great deal of creativity and experience to Spring Creek Town Center.

 

Owned by the Mother/Daughter Duo of Dawn Kimball and Jessica Wolfenden, the studio is a “must see” for visitors.

The gallery of photos leave no doubt that these are people who know photography. Dawn and Jessie represent three generations of photography experience in this community. And their passion for the art shows in every piece of photography they create.

Swank & Savvy

 

Swank & Savvy is the newest addition to The Shops at Spring Creek. It is Cleveland’s new and premier event planning shop, offering services for any party, wedding, or event. They also offer a unique coffee catering experience adding a modern edge to your event. Clark and Kristen Campbell have partnered with Danny and Deborah Samuelson to open their Swank & Savvy shop.  Grand Opening festivities were held Aug. 10.

 

The coffee catering offers a full line of Atlanta’s premier roasters, Land of a Thousand Hills coffee and as well as latte.
